I have to confess that I am the sort of person who easily feels seduced whenever a good or interesting story is told and this particular project has enough history to get me seduced from the very first moment.Coming from one of the smallest protected denominations in Portugal, the Carcavelos´ wines have been an international reference for quite some centuries now making themselves present in the market of fortified wines mainly dominated by Port and Madeira wines.
With a strong historical connection to the emblematic Portuguese minister Marques de Pombal who became famous for his reconstruction of Lisbon after the earthquake of 1755, this fortified wine has known a new life recently, being integrated in a project of the Municipality of Oeiras in order to grant it some support and more visibility.
